Is any relief from wildfires, extreme heat on the horizon for Minnesota?
Meteorologist Sven Sundgaard is in with a look at Northern Minnesota wildfire smoke causing hazardous levels of air quality in parts of the state, and how that smoke may reach the Twin Cities early Thursday. Plus, when and where much needed rain could possibly fall across Minnesota. Sven also has the latest outlook on when the extreme heat will break.
